Breaking News: Limerick Council Plans €60,000 Golf Ball Display Ahead of 2027 Ryder Cup

Limerick is preparing for one of the biggest sporting events ever staged in Ireland, with the county council planning to spend approximately €60,000 on giant branded golf balls ahead of the 2027 Ryder Cup. The promotional installations are intended to welcome hundreds of thousands of visitors expected to travel to Adare for the tournament.

What is happening in Limerick?

Limerick City and County Council plans to place 10 oversized golf balls at strategic locations across the county. The displays will form part of a wider promotional effort linked to the Ryder Cup, which will take place at Adare Manor in September 2027.

The proposed investment works out at an estimated average of €6,000 per golf ball, although the available information does not provide a detailed breakdown of the total cost or the exact sites selected for the installations.

Why the 2027 Ryder Cup matters to Limerick

The Ryder Cup is expected to generate significant international attention for Adare, Limerick and the wider Mid-West region. The biennial golf contest brings together teams representing Europe and the United States and attracts major global television audiences, travelling supporters and large numbers of visitors.

For local authorities, the event is more than a sporting competition. It represents an opportunity to promote Limerick as a destination for tourism, hospitality, business and future events. Giant golf-ball displays could help create a visible connection between communities, transport routes and the tournament venue.

Promoting Ireland’s Ryder Cup host region

The decision comes as preparations build for the first Ryder Cup to be held in Ireland. Adare Manor, owned by businessman JP McManus, will host the tournament on its championship course. The venue has already hosted high-profile golf events and is expected to become a focal point for international visitors during the competition.

The displays are likely to be aimed at visitors arriving through the county, as well as residents and businesses preparing for the increased activity. Their final locations and designs will determine how effectively they connect the tournament with Limerick’s towns, villages and public spaces.

Potential benefits and questions for local residents

Large-scale event branding can provide a simple way to build anticipation and improve a destination’s visual identity. It may also support local businesses by signalling that the county is ready to welcome visitors before the tournament begins.

At the same time, public spending on promotional features can attract scrutiny, particularly when councils face competing demands for housing, roads, public services and community facilities. The available report confirms the estimated €60,000 cost, but does not set out the procurement process, maintenance arrangements or whether additional sponsorship or event funding will contribute to the project.

Those details will be important for residents seeking to understand the value of the investment and the responsibilities attached to the installations after the Ryder Cup ends.
